Fixing Fridge Door Sag: Easy Steps To Adjust Hinges

how to adjust hinges on refrigerator door

Adjusting the hinges on a refrigerator door is a common task that can help ensure the door seals properly, preventing cold air from escaping and improving energy efficiency. Over time, the door may sag or become misaligned due to frequent use or wear and tear, causing gaps around the seal. Most refrigerator doors are equipped with adjustable hinges, typically located at the top and bottom, which allow for fine-tuning to realign the door. By using basic tools like a screwdriver or hex key, you can loosen the hinge screws, adjust the door’s position, and tighten the screws once the alignment is correct. This process not only enhances the refrigerator’s functionality but also extends its lifespan by reducing strain on the gasket and internal components.

Adjust Door Alignment: Loosen hinge screws, align the door, and tighten securely

Misaligned refrigerator doors not only compromise the seal but also lead to energy inefficiency and food spoilage. The culprit often lies in the hinges, which can shift over time due to frequent use or settling of the appliance. Adjusting door alignment begins with a straightforward process: loosen the hinge screws, realign the door, and tighten securely. This method is both cost-effective and accessible, requiring minimal tools and no professional expertise.

To execute this adjustment, start by identifying the hinge screws, typically located at the top and bottom of the door. Use a screwdriver to loosen them slightly—avoid removing them entirely, as this can destabilize the door. With the screws loosened, manually adjust the door to achieve proper alignment. Ensure the door is level and flush with the refrigerator body, checking the gap around the seal for uniformity. A helpful tip is to use a level or a straightedge to verify alignment, especially if the door appears crooked.

Once aligned, tighten the screws securely but avoid over-tightening, as this can strip the threads or warp the hinge. Test the door by opening and closing it several times to confirm it operates smoothly and seals tightly. If the seal still appears uneven, repeat the process, making incremental adjustments until the door sits perfectly. This step-by-step approach ensures precision and avoids unnecessary strain on the hinge mechanism.

Comparatively, this method is far simpler than replacing hinges or calling a technician, making it an ideal first step for troubleshooting. However, it’s crucial to exercise caution: avoid forcing the door into position, as this can damage the hinges or misalign the seal further. For older refrigerators or those with persistent issues, consider inspecting the hinge pins and bushings for wear, as these components may require lubrication or replacement. Check Leveling: Ensure the refrigerator is level to avoid uneven door movement

A refrigerator that isn't level can cause its doors to swing open or close unevenly, leading to improper sealing and potential energy loss. Before diving into hinge adjustments, it’s critical to verify the appliance’s stability. Place a carpenter’s level on the top surface of the refrigerator, checking both front-to-back and side-to-side alignment. Most models require a tilt of approximately 1/8 inch toward the rear for proper door closure, but consult your manual for specific recommendations. If the bubble isn’t centered, proceed to the next steps.

To level the refrigerator, locate the adjustable feet at the base, typically found at the front corners. Turn the feet clockwise to raise them or counterclockwise to lower them, using a wrench if necessary. Make small adjustments, rechecking the level after each turn to avoid over-correction. For units with rear rollers, tilt the refrigerator forward slightly by pulling it out, then adjust the front feet while ensuring the rollers remain in contact with the floor. This dual-adjustment approach ensures stability without compromising functionality.

Ignoring leveling issues can exacerbate hinge problems, as uneven weight distribution strains door mechanisms. For example, a refrigerator tilted to one side may cause the door to sag, putting additional pressure on the hinges and leading to premature wear. In contrast, a properly leveled unit distributes weight evenly, allowing hinges to operate smoothly and reducing the need for frequent adjustments. This simple step can save time and prevent unnecessary repairs down the line.

Test Door Swing: Verify the door closes smoothly and seals tightly after adjustments

A properly adjusted refrigerator door is not just about aesthetics; it’s a matter of functionality and energy efficiency. After making hinge adjustments, testing the door swing is the critical final step to ensure your efforts weren't in vain. Start by opening the door to a 90-degree angle and releasing it. Observe whether it closes on its own without hesitation or resistance. A door that hangs open or requires manual assistance to close indicates misalignment or insufficient tension, which can lead to cold air escaping and increased energy consumption.

Next, inspect the seal. Close the door gently and check if the gasket makes uniform contact with the frame. Use a dollar bill test for precision: place a bill between the gasket and frame, then close the door. If the bill slides out easily, the seal is compromised. Common culprits include warped gaskets, debris, or uneven hinge adjustments. Address these issues by cleaning the gasket, ensuring it’s pliable, and rechecking hinge alignment. A tight seal not only preserves temperature but also prevents moisture buildup, which can lead to mold or frost.

For a more thorough test, observe the door’s behavior under different conditions. Open and close it multiple times, varying the force applied. A well-adjusted door should respond consistently, neither slamming shut nor requiring excessive effort. If the door swings shut too quickly, the hinges may be over-tightened, while a sluggish close suggests insufficient tension. Fine-tune the hinges incrementally, testing after each adjustment to avoid overcorrection. Patience here pays off, as small tweaks can yield significant improvements.
